Example to Calculate Rates Based on a Retained Grade Rate

In this example, you calculate grade rate values for annual salary payments based on a retained grade rate without steps.

Scenario

Julianna is a Product Manager at grade 5 in the Product Manager grade ladder. As part of a company reorganization, she's moved from grade 5 to grade 4. The company put her on a retained grade of 5 for a period of 2 years. During this retained period, she will be paid the higher of her assignment grade.

In this example, you calculate grade rate values for her annual salary payments based on retained grades.

Configuration

Follow these steps to calculate rate values for Julianna:

  1. Set up grades, grade ladder, and rates for the Product Manager job to record the level of compensation for product managers.

    • Use the Manage Grade task to set up separate grades 1 to 8.

    • For each grade, enter the annual salary as shown in this table.

  2. Create a rate definition based on grade rate details. Add a rate contributor of type Retained Grade Ladder.

  3. Associate a context with the Grade Retention Info page. You must associate a context for the assignment extensible flexfield to record the retained grade information. You can either associate this context with an existing page or you could create a new page based on your requirements. For more information on how to set up contexts, refer to the topic: Create Grade Retention Page and Associate With Retained Grade Context.

  4. On the Additional Info page, set the Primary Indicator. Use the Additional Assignment Info task to set up the retained grade details.

    • On the Additional Assignment Info page, search for and select the employee.

    • In the Info Group field, select Grade Retained Info.

    • In the Retained Grade section, click Add.

    • In the Primary Indicator field, select Yes.

      Note: If you select the value as No, the application doesn't return any rate.

    • In the Grade Ladder field, select your grade ladder.

    • In the Grade field, select Grade 5.

  5. Run the Generate HCM Rates process to calculate the rates based on the information held in the grade tables.

Results

The application returns a rate value of 135900.
